					<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p class="p1">When you think of a stereotypical prison, what first springs to mind is likely something along the lines of New York City&rsquo;s infamous Riker&rsquo;s Island, which has been used as a model for many Hollywood productions over the years. Prisoners either bunk within two-person cells, in their own solitary confinement cells, or in large, open rooms full of beds. These bland, gray concrete and cinder block spaces are virtually identical, with few adornments or embellishments.</p>

<p class="p1">In reality, prison living conditions vary widely, from the inhumane conditions of maximum security facilities to the veritable motels where white-collar criminals are held. In the United States, which has the highest incarceration rate in the world with almost 2.3 million people behind bars, <a href="https://eji.org/issues/prison-conditions/" rel="noopener noreferrer" target="_blank">many facilities are deteriorating, overcrowded, and violent places</a> of institutional corruption and abuse of power. Even worse, private prisons house 8.2 percent of all state and federal prisoners, including people detained by immigration officials, making revenues of about $4 billion a year.</p>
<p class="p1">The actual material conditions of these prisons make those seen in series like <em>The Wire</em> and <em>Orange is the New Black</em> look like vacation resorts. And it&rsquo;s true that many other countries around the world are similarly abusive and exploitative, or worse. But not every prison around the world looks as you&rsquo;d imagine. In Ukraine, even maximum security men&rsquo;s prisons have a surprising amount of personality (and even a sense of domesticity).</p>

<p class="p1">In a recent piece for <em><a href="https://www.nytimes.com/2020/04/23/opinion/sunday/ukraine-prison-decor.html" rel="noopener noreferrer" target="_blank">The New York Times</a></em>, photojournalist Misha Friedman explores some of these fascinating spaces, and the contrasts he finds with American prisons are sure to shock you.</p>
<p class="p1">Friedman writes that he &ldquo;first visited Ukrainian prisons in 2009, while working on a project for Doctors Without Borders. I remember seeing the conjugal rooms and being struck by how no two rooms were alike,&rdquo; he says. &ldquo;I wondered whether we could learn something about a country by observing the places where the incarcerated live. I returned to Ukraine nine years later after securing wide-ranging access to photograph the country&rsquo;s penal system.&rdquo;</p>
<p class="p1"><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" alt="Female inmates gather to watch television in a bright, spacious-feeling common area." height="960" src="https://cimg3.ibsrv.net/cimg/www.dornob.com/1128x960_85/103/Misha-Friedman-Ukraine-Prisons-women-s-Kamenskoe-595103.png" width="1127" class="" title="Inside the Unique Cells of Ukrainian Prisons   " /></p>
<p class="p1">&ldquo;I visited 17 prisons all over the country: maximum security, pretrial, men&rsquo;s and women&rsquo;s, and one juvenile. Prisoners decorate their own rooms. There&rsquo;s no budget, no guidelines, or any kind of code that dictates what rooms should look like. The rooms are reflective of not only their taste but also of an impoverished institution. Perhaps a wall is painted green because the warden was able to procure a few cans from the local paint shop, as a barter for some pickled cabbage made in the prison&rsquo;s kitchen. Three of the prisons I visited had only <a href="https://dornob.com/the-forgotten-residents-of-georgias-abandoned-soviet-era-spas/" rel="noopener noreferrer" target="_blank">recently closed</a>. I could still feel the essence of the people who had inhabited these spaces.&rdquo;</p>
<p class="p1"><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" alt="A photo of boxer Mike Tyson graces the inside of this Ukrainian prison cell." height="960" src="https://cimg0.ibsrv.net/cimg/www.dornob.com/1112x960_85/108/Misha-Friedman-Ukraine-Prisons-men-s-Chernigov-595108.png" width="1112" class="" title="Inside the Unique Cells of Ukrainian Prisons    " /></p>
<p class="p1">In the United States, the prevailing attitude about prisons is that they&rsquo;re full of bad people who made bad choices, and that those people deserve whatever they get. The system is <a href="https://www.thenation.com/article/archive/what-is-prison-abolition/" rel="noopener nofollow noreferrer" target="_blank">based on punishment rather than rehabilitation,</a> often reinforcing criminality instead of reforming it. There&rsquo;s little public support for treating prisoners as human beings who can change, given the proper resources.</p>

					<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Cultural zeitgeists have a way of influencing architecture and design. It&rsquo;s a trend that has lasted centuries and continues to evolve today. Unfortunately, the prevalence of mass shootings, public violence, and terrorist threats is quickly becoming the catalyst for yet another architectural movement &mdash; one that national security site <a href="https://warontherocks.com/" rel="nofollow noopener noreferrer" target="_blank"><em>War on the Rocks</em></a> is labeling &#8220;crisis architecture.&#8221;</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400"><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" alt="Military personnel move through a school to protect students during a mass shooting" height="850" src="https://cimg0.ibsrv.net/cimg/www.dornob.com/1330x850_85/784/crisis-arch-main-575784.jpg" width="1330" class="" title="Crisis Architecture " /></span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Even the earliest building blueprints included considerations for what was happening in the world at the time. For example, forts like Brimstone Hill Fortress on the Caribbean Island of St. Kitts were intentionally placed on higher ground so as to provide their occupants with optimal views of approaching invaders. Even in the medieval age of castles, monarchs included lookout towers, moats, and other seemingly impenetrable lines of defense to serve specific purposes. Later, the idea of <a href="https://dornob.com/ring-releases-new-range-of-smart-motion-sensor-lighting/" rel="noopener noreferrer" target="_blank">urban safety</a> influenced designs for municipal buildings and residential housing alike. Today we have a different kind of enemy to protect against: individuals who perpetrate mass shootings or other types of terror attacks. </span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">As a result of these attacks, we&rsquo;re already seeing huge changes in urban planning. This encompasses infrastructure to mitigate attacks on high-rise buildings from car and other streetside bombs. It also entails putting barriers up around buildings and <a href="https://dornob.com/iconic-monument-to-archbishop-desmond-tutu-unveiled-on-his-birthday/" rel="noopener noreferrer" target="_blank">monuments</a>. However, these steps do little to protect against the damage one might cause once they&#8217;re inside those buildings.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">The statistics are alarming to say the least. As of December 1st, 2019, there have been 385 mass shootings in the U.S. <em>this year</em>, according to data from the nonprofit <a href="https://www.gunviolencearchive.org/" rel="nofollow noopener noreferrer" target="_blank">Gun Violence Archive (GVA)</a>. That&rsquo;s an average of more than one mass shooting per day. Even worse, 29 of these incidents resulted in mass murders, which begs the question, &ldquo;What can we do about it?&rdquo; The answer might just be in architectural protection.</span></p>

<p><span style="font-weight: 400">This idea integrates more than typical safety precautions that protect against crime, such as placing bars on the windows or installing deadbolts. In fact, it requires an entirely new way of thinking about architecture. That&rsquo;s because terror attacks and shootings (and even mass stabbings) happen in a second. There&rsquo;s no time to rely on a police response. Studies of mass shootings in recent years calculate the average time between an attacker entering the building and the end of the shooting is less than ten minutes. Crisis architecture means installing systems that work to save lives by offering protection the moment a crisis begins. </span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Although there have been attacks in workplaces, <a href="https://dornob.com/okuda-san-miguel-turns-100-year-old-church-into-kaleidoscopic-skate-park/" rel="noopener noreferrer" target="_blank">churches</a>, and even movie theaters before, the dozens of school shootings in just the past decade make for the best example of how crisis architecture could prevent tragedies in the future. Learning from past attacks, schools recognize the need to be able to lock classrooms from the inside, easily lockdown an entire campus, and use cameras to spot attackers before they even enter the building. Unfortunately, measures like these have mostly been met with uncertainty by school districts for several reasons, including issues with student privacy, lack of viable information about what works, and high costs. </span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Crisis architecture is the idea that systems can be standardized and integrated from the blueprint stage rather than by looking towards temporary solutions for individual situations. This allows all the systems within the building to work together in a discreet and fluid way as a functional part of the overall design.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400"><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" alt="Early schematics for public housing complex work in a few key defense features" height="850" src="https://cimg2.ibsrv.net/cimg/www.dornob.com/1330x850_85/782/crisis-arch-2-575782.jpg" width="1330" class="" title="Crisis Architecture at the Blueprint Level " /></span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">Specifically, <em>War on the Rocks</em> identifies eight key functionalities that would maximize physical defenses for public buildings. </span></p>
<ol>
<li style="font-weight: 400"><span style="font-weight: 400"><em>Enable Creation of Distance:</em> This basically means improving traffic flow within the building by incorporating more corridors and stairways to handle mass migrations. </span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400"><span style="font-weight: 400"><em>Safe Exit from Multiple Points</em>: The design should provide multiple avenues for safely getting out of the building in the case of an attack.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400"><span style="font-weight: 400"><em>Incorporate Angles to Limit a Shooter&rsquo;s Line of Sight</em>: Build in natural and appealing blockades that limit endless site in long hallways or from a doorway. This gives victims places to seek shelter and limits an attacker&rsquo;s ability to target people.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400"><span style="font-weight: 400"><em>Provide Adequate Cover and Concealment</em>: This includes the incorporation of bullet-proof features, as well as wall and furniture placement for better concealment.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400"><span style="font-weight: 400"><em>Enable Rapid Hardening of a Facility:</em> This covers systems such as deadbolts, window coverings, and ballistic doors that automatically engage at the sound of an alarm.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400"><span style="font-weight: 400"><em>Implement &ldquo;Human-Centered Design&rdquo; Concepts</em>: Work with the basic human fight-or-flight response to predict how people will act during a crisis.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400"><span style="font-weight: 400"><em>Training and Design Need to be Mutually Supporting</em>: This means coordinating crisis training with the infrastructure in ways that make it possible to either stay in one&#8217;s current location or quickly and safely escape. </span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400"><span style="font-weight: 400"><em>Integrate Systems to Increase the Situational Awareness of First Responders</em>: Installation of systems that give first responders the information they need.</span></li>
</ol>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400">So the question remains, given the desired level of security and all the associated costs, is crisis architecture the way of the future?</span></p><p>The post <a href="https://dornob.com/is-crisis-architecture-the-way-of-the-future/">Is “Crisis Architecture” the Way of the Future?</a> first appeared on <a href="https://dornob.com">Dornob</a>.</p>]]></content:encoded>

					<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>In Hollywood depictions of crime scene investigation, suspenseful plots nicely unfold in an hour or so, the damning piece of evidence is found under a fingernail, and cops always move on to the next case. In reality, crime scenes often have nothing to offer except unidentifiable rotting corpses, resulting in in an extremely daunting, ever-increasing number of cold cases.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-61595"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/01/dubai1.jpg" alt="One of Dubai's crime scene investigators taking pictures of a corpse on a bed." width="1200" height="675" srcset="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/01/dubai1.jpg 1200w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/01/dubai1-468x263.jpg 468w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/01/dubai1-768x432.jpg 768w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/01/dubai1-1024x576.jpg 1024w" sizes="(max-width: 1200px) 100vw, 1200px" /></p>
<p>Now, Dubai police are hoping to solve some of those <a href="https://dornob.com/berlin-subway-station-to-use-anxiety-inducing-music-to-stop-crime/" target="_blank" rel="noopener">crimes</a> with the help of bugs — more specifically, the kind that feast on human flesh.</p>
<h2>A Bug’s Life (and Larvae)</h2>
<p>If you’ve ever happened upon a decomposing animal in the woods, you&#8217;ll probably find it hard to forget the countless creatures you saw squirming around the carcass. They’re varied species of bugs of arthropods (spineless animals with external skeletons), each snacking on everything from the ears to the tail. The infestation may seem random, but each one of these insects prefers to feast on specific specific body parts, and all of them plant larvae in the corpse&#8217;s decaying flesh. That&#8217;s where the Dubai police come in.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-61593"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/01/dubai3.jpg" alt="Several men walking out of a Dubai court room." width="1024" height="576" srcset="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/01/dubai3.jpg 1024w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/01/dubai3-468x263.jpg 468w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/01/dubai3-768x432.jpg 768w" sizes="(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px" /></p>
<p>By monitoring the activities of the insects native to the <a href="https://dornob.com/can-placemaking-work-in-abu-dhabi/" target="_blank" rel="noopener">United Arab Emirates</a> and the the growth of their larvae, forensic experts can approximate how long a body has been dead. Factors such as the environmental temperature and place of death can also be determined this way, providing investigators with information that could prove instrumental in determining time of death and narrowing down potential suspects, as well as helping them build a stronger case in court.</p>
<h2>Bringing in the Pros</h2>
<p>Seeing the potential behind these creepy-crawlies, the UAE government turned to Dr. Jeffrey D. Wells, an expert in forensic entomology at <a href="https://www.fiu.edu/" target="_blank" rel="nofollow noopener">Florida International University</a>. Wells was brought on board to develop and oversee fresh research, establish a new database, and train Dubai&#8217;s police officers about bugs and their habits to help increase their crime-solving success rate.</p>
<p>Dr. Wells says of the initiative: “It is very exciting to work with a government agency that is so interested in improving what they do and moving into new topics. We intend to take this project and expand it out into a more comprehensive understanding of forensic entomology [the study of insects and their arthropod relatives that inhabit decomposing remains] within the UAE and the wider region.”</p>
<p>Last year, 22 of Dubai&#8217;s finest DNA experts and crime scene investigators completed an interactive forensic entomology course. Its curriculum was comprised of in-depth studies on several different species of bug and their larvae&#8217;s distinct shapes, as well as growth statistics, species allocation, and the types of toxins found in insect tissue — all of which can be used to create more successful and expedient criminal investigations.</p>

					<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Berlin is often thought of as a liberal bastion where creativity and free expression reign supreme. There has been a particularly large influx of foreigners moving to the German capital in recent years for the city&#8217;s vibrant nightlife, cheap rent, and good quality of life — an influx that has started to anger some of the locals. Now, a controversial new policy is looking to redefine the notion of security in the city. Slated to be trialed in one of Berlin’s many bustling subway stations, this tactic has already been deemed offensive and exploitative by some, and not at all in the spirit of the inclusive metropolis that characterizes Berlin’s identity.</span></p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-59972"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/berlin-www.wikipedia.com_.jpg" alt="Berlin " width="800" height="450" srcset="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/berlin-www.wikipedia.com_.jpg 800w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/berlin-www.wikipedia.com_-468x263.jpg 468w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/berlin-www.wikipedia.com_-768x432.jpg 768w" sizes="(max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px" /></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;"><a href="https://www.bahn.com/i/view/index.shtml" target="_blank" rel="nofollow noopener">Deutsche Bahn</a>, the German national rail network, will soon try playing atonal music in Berlin’s Hermannstrasse station in hopes of reducing crime and deterring loitering. This music has been proven to agitate some listeners, creating a feeling of anxiety within them by increasing their blood pressure and level of auditory discomfort. DB hopes that the music, which is decidedly unmelodic, will sufficiently deter crime without disturbing all the passengers. Friedemann Kessler, the company&#8217;s Eastern Regional Manager, says: &#8220;Few people find it beautiful — many people perceive it as something to run away from.&#8221;</span></p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-59973"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/neukolln-www.derspiegel.com_.jpg" alt="Berlin Subway Station " width="800" height="450" srcset="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/neukolln-www.derspiegel.com_.jpg 800w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/neukolln-www.derspiegel.com_-468x263.jpg 468w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/neukolln-www.derspiegel.com_-768x432.jpg 768w" sizes="(max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px" /></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">This strategy is proving to be quite controversial, as while the station has experienced numerous instances of crime, including a man kicking a woman down the stairs and high rates of drug use, it is also commonly used as a refuge by homeless people. <a href="https://www.inm-berlin.de/en/" target="_blank" rel="nofollow noopener">Initiative Neue Musik</a>, an organization that celebrates contemporary music, has even launched a counter-initiative in response to the trial. Members of INM have explicitly spoken out against the trial, believing that “art should not be weaponized&#8221; and staging several atonal music concerts to make a mockery of the proposal. The group successfully organized a peaceful recital outside the station, bringing food with them to encourage homeless people to come and feel included.</span></p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-59975"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/atonal-music-concert-www.guardian.com_.jpg" alt="Atonal Music Concert " width="800" height="480" srcset="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/atonal-music-concert-www.guardian.com_.jpg 800w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/atonal-music-concert-www.guardian.com_-468x281.jpg 468w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/atonal-music-concert-www.guardian.com_-768x461.jpg 768w" sizes="(max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px" /></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">The group reported that Friedemann Kessler was also in attendance at the protest. By the time the concert finished, he apparently wanted to rescind his plans to play atonal music at the station, having been educated on its true origins by the performance.</span></p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-59974"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/sbahn-www.dezeen.com_.jpg" alt="Berlin Subway Station " width="800" height="450" srcset="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/sbahn-www.dezeen.com_.jpg 800w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/sbahn-www.dezeen.com_-468x263.jpg 468w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/09/sbahn-www.dezeen.com_-768x432.jpg 768w" sizes="(max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px" /></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">While this particular plan is considered by many to be a hostile form of discouragement, it is not uncommon for transport hubs to employ music as a tool to calm or soothe passengers. Stations in Montreal and London have experimented with playing classical music, for instance, as it has been proven to quell antisocial behaviors. Other initiatives have involved changing the lighting in subway stations or experimenting with perfumes thought to engender feelings of positivity. It&#8217;s undoubtedly a more empathetic strategy to try and create positive feelings instead of negative ones, so it&#8217;s perhaps no wonder that the atonal music strategy was a non-starter, especially in a city as progressive as Berlin. </span></p><p>The post <a href="https://dornob.com/berlin-subway-station-to-use-anxiety-inducing-music-to-stop-crime/">Berlin Subway Station to Use Anxiety-Inducing Music to Stop Crime</a> first appeared on <a href="https://dornob.com">Dornob</a>.</p>]]></content:encoded>

					<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Despite all their well-publicized challenges, today&#8217;s cities are still regarded as immense sources of untapped potential. Architects and other designers are constantly expected to get involved in or provide solutions for the environment, transit, affordability, business, and infrastructure in most cities. At <a href="https://www.gold.ac.uk" target="_blank" rel="nofollow noopener">Goldsmiths, University of London</a>, one research agency is now using architecture to solve crimes committed by individuals, corporations, and governments. More specifically, <a href="https://www.forensic-architecture.org/" target="_blank" rel="nofollow noopener">Forensic Architecture (FA)</a> pairs investigative scientific practices with the digital tools used to design the built environment in order to recreate crime scenes.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-58783"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image1_Rendering-and-animation-of-a-2016-Syrian-Government-bombing-of-a-hospital-in-Aleppo_Source-forensic-architecture.org_.jpg" alt="Forensic Architecture Renderings " width="800" height="446" srcset="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image1_Rendering-and-animation-of-a-2016-Syrian-Government-bombing-of-a-hospital-in-Aleppo_Source-forensic-architecture.org_.jpg 800w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image1_Rendering-and-animation-of-a-2016-Syrian-Government-bombing-of-a-hospital-in-Aleppo_Source-forensic-architecture.org_-468x261.jpg 468w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image1_Rendering-and-animation-of-a-2016-Syrian-Government-bombing-of-a-hospital-in-Aleppo_Source-forensic-architecture.org_-768x428.jpg 768w" sizes="(max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px" /></p>
<p>To understand the importance of Forensic Architecture, it helps to consider a city dealing with the fallout from something like multiple days of demonstrations during a summit of world leaders. During these meetings, most protestors will exercise their right to free speech, and some of them may even approach the demonstrations with more anarchic motives. The latter group is often dealt with more harshly by law enforcement, which sometimes results in individual members of riot squads being accused of violating human rights.</p>
<p>In some cases, these accusations are backed up by video evidence, but in many others they are not. When crimes are witnessed by others in person but there is no recording of the incident, law enforcement may try to spin the events in their favor. Thanks to forensic architecture, these narratives can now be challenged with scientific evidence.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-58782"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image2_Investigating-how-drone-strikes-destroy-villages_Source-forensic-architecture.org_.jpg" alt="Forensic Architecture Renderings" width="800" height="429" srcset="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image2_Investigating-how-drone-strikes-destroy-villages_Source-forensic-architecture.org_.jpg 800w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image2_Investigating-how-drone-strikes-destroy-villages_Source-forensic-architecture.org_-468x251.jpg 468w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image2_Investigating-how-drone-strikes-destroy-villages_Source-forensic-architecture.org_-768x412.jpg 768w" sizes="(max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px" /></p>
<p>Since 2011, FA’s team of architects, investigative journalists, filmmakers, designers, coders, psychologists, archaeologists, and human rights activists have been recreating crimes by taking advantage of all available information in the public domain, as well as the information kept by nearby third parties. This includes personal videos, social media posts, sounds picked up by microphones and cameras at the scene, and eye-witness accounts. When all of this data is entered into an architectural software, both the scene and the incident can be digitally rendered. When more is required, FA relies on animations, maps, physical models, and drawings to expose the truth of the matter.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-58781"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image3_Investigating-the-2012-Ali-Enterprises-Factory-Fire-Karachi-Pakistan_Source-forensic-architecture.org_.jpg" alt="Forensic Architecture Investigation" width="800" height="425" srcset="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image3_Investigating-the-2012-Ali-Enterprises-Factory-Fire-Karachi-Pakistan_Source-forensic-architecture.org_.jpg 800w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image3_Investigating-the-2012-Ali-Enterprises-Factory-Fire-Karachi-Pakistan_Source-forensic-architecture.org_-468x249.jpg 468w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image3_Investigating-the-2012-Ali-Enterprises-Factory-Fire-Karachi-Pakistan_Source-forensic-architecture.org_-768x408.jpg 768w" sizes="(max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px" /></p>
<p>The research agency has also investigated genocides in Guatemala and World War II concentration camps, police brutality in Gaza, the destruction of small villages by drone strikes, hospitals that were purposely bombed in Syria, and the 2017 Grenfell Tower fire in London, where 71 people perished. Their work is highly sought after by organizations such as <a href="https://www.amnesty.org/en/"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Amnesty International</a> and <a href="https://www.hrw.org"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Human Rights Watch,</a> as well as lawyers, activists, and adversarial journalists.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-58780"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image4_Forensis-Exhibition-in-Berlin-in-2014_Photo-by-forensic-architecture.org_Source-Facebook.com_.jpg" alt="FORENSIS Exhibition 2014" width="800" height="593" srcset="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image4_Forensis-Exhibition-in-Berlin-in-2014_Photo-by-forensic-architecture.org_Source-Facebook.com_.jpg 800w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image4_Forensis-Exhibition-in-Berlin-in-2014_Photo-by-forensic-architecture.org_Source-Facebook.com_-468x347.jpg 468w, https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2018/05/Image4_Forensis-Exhibition-in-Berlin-in-2014_Photo-by-forensic-architecture.org_Source-Facebook.com_-768x569.jpg 768w" sizes="(max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px" /></p>
<p>The work performed by Forensic Architecture takes on more significance when you consider the crimes, human rights violations, and increasing urbanization taking place in countries all over the world. Many of these incidents are taking place in cities, where we have the technology to document incidents for further review. Although many are concerned with privacy and the personal information being collected, Forensic Architecture has shown that it can all be used for good. This does not mean that our cities will be safer, but it does prove how powerful architecture can be when removed from the aesthetic realm and employed purely for justice.</p><p>The post <a href="https://dornob.com/how-forensic-architecture-helps-solve-human-rights-violations/">How Forensic Architecture Helps Solve Human Rights Violations</a> first appeared on <a href="https://dornob.com">Dornob</a>.</p>]]></content:encoded>

<p>Homebrewing alcohol has been attracting a rather large following in the United States and some other countries, but the in-home production of alcohol is prohibited in many parts of the world. The Prohibition Kit from designer <a href="http://www.morackini.com/">Francesco Morackini</a> is a cheeky take on the hobby and its rather shady origins.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-37801" title="prohibition kit homemade alcohol"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/04/prohibition-kit-homemade-alcohol.jpg" alt="" width="467" height="274" /></p>
<p>During Prohibition in the U.S., some crafty folks with the right equipment and the right knowledge made their own liquor to get past the country&#8217;s outright outlawing of the substance. However, getting caught meant stiff punishments. So the smart bootleggers discovered how to disguise their equipment and their work spaces.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-37802" title="components of prohibition kit"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/04/components-of-prohibition-kit.jpg" alt="" width="468" height="367" /></p>
<p>The Prohibition Kit does the same thing, but with the added benefit of almost an entire century of additional manufacturing technology. Morackini&#8217;s kit features four separate objects that can be used as perfectly legal items in the home: a pot, a watering can, a fruit bowl and a fondue pot. Separately, they are innocent and commonly seen in many kitchens.</p>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ignnone size-full wp-image-37803" title="how to use the prohibition kit" src="https://dornob.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/04/how-to-use-the-prohibition-kit.jpg" alt="" width="468" height="662" /></p>
<p>Put them together, however, and the common kitchen objects become a fully functional alcohol still. You can make your own schnapps at home, and between uses no one will be the wiser about the actual intended function of each of the components. As the designer points out, you can even use each of these items in the growing of the fruit for the alcohol. The intentionally provocative project brings up some challenging questions: when do everyday items become criminalized, and when do our governments have the right to restrict the use of certain objects based solely on their potential to one day be used in a crime?</p><p>The post <a href="https://dornob.com/cheeky-kitchen-objects-hide-a-provocative-secret-function/">Cheeky Kitchen Objects Hide a Provocative Secret Function</a> first appeared on <a href="https://dornob.com">Dornob</a>.</p>]]></content:encoded>
